What are the Pharmaceutical Sector Stocks?
Pharmaceutical sector stocks are shares of companies involved in research, development, manufacturing, and distribution of medicines, vaccines, diagnostics, and healthcare products.
The pharmaceutical industry encompasses businesses that cater to a wide range of healthcare needs, from treating common illnesses to developing therapies for complex diseases. These companies may operate in areas such as generic drugs, branded formulations, active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s), biotechnology, contract manufacturing, and specialty medicines.
India is one of the world's largest producers of generic medicines and pharmaceutical exports, making the sector an important contributor to the country's economy. As a result, pharmaceutical shares are often considered a significant segment of the healthcare sector in the stock market.
Things to Consider Before Investing in the Pharmaceutical Sector Stocks
Before investing in pharmaceutical stocks, it is important to evaluate the factors that can influence the performance of companies operating in this sector:
1. Regulatory Approvals and Compliance:
Pharmaceutical companies operate in a highly regulated environment. Approvals from regulatory authorities and compliance with manufacturing standards can significantly impact business growth and profitability.2. Research and Development (R&D) Capabilities:
Innovation is a major growth driver in the pharmaceutical industry. Companies that invest consistently in research and development may have better opportunities to launch new products and expand their market presence.3. Product Portfolio Diversification:
A diversified product portfolio helps reduce dependence on a limited number of drugs or therapeutic categories. Investors may prefer companies with a broad range of products across multiple healthcare segments.4. Export Exposure:
Many Indian pharmaceutical companies generate a significant portion of revenue from international markets. Global demand, currency movements, and overseas regulations can influence earnings.5. Patent and Competition Risks:
Patent expirations and increasing competition from generic manufacturers can affect revenues. Understanding a company's competitive position is essential before investing.6. Financial Strength:
Revenue growth, profit margins, debt levels, cash flows, and return ratios are important indicators when evaluating pharmaceutical sector shares.
What are the Benefits of Investing in the Pharmaceutical Sector Stocks?
Investors often consider pharmaceutical sector stocks for several reasons:
1. Growing Healthcare Demand:
Rising healthcare awareness, increasing life expectancy, and expanding access to medical services continue to support long-term demand for pharmaceutical products.2. Defensive Nature of the Sector:
Healthcare remains an essential need regardless of economic conditions. This often makes pharmaceutical shares relatively resilient compared to some cyclical sectors.3. Global Growth Opportunities:
Many Indian pharmaceutical companies have a strong presence in international markets, creating opportunities for revenue growth beyond domestic demand.4. Innovation-Led Expansion:
Advancements in biotechnology, specialty medicines, vaccines, and drug development can create new growth avenues for companies in the sector.5. Government Healthcare Initiatives:
Healthcare-focused policies, increased public health spending, and support for domestic pharmaceutical manufacturing can benefit companies across the industry.
What are the Different Types of Companies in the Pharmaceutical Sector?
The pharmaceutical sector shares list includes companies operating across various segments of the healthcare ecosystem.
1. Generic Drug Manufacturers:
These companies produce cost-effective versions of medicines after the original patents expire. India is a global leader in generic drug manufacturing.2. Branded Formulation Companies:
They develop and market branded medicines for various therapeutic areas such as cardiology, diabetes, gastroenterology, and respiratory care.3. API Manufacturers:
Active Pharmaceutical Ingredient (API) companies manufacture the core ingredients used in drug production and supply them to pharmaceutical manufacturers worldwide.4. Biotechnology Companies:
Biotech firms focus on developing advanced therapies, vaccines, biologics, and innovative healthcare solutions through scientific research.5. Contract Research and Manufacturing Companies (CRAMS):
These businesses provide research, development, and manufacturing services to global pharmaceutical companies, helping streamline drug development and production.6. Specialty Pharmaceutical Companies:
These companies focus on niche therapeutic segments and high-value treatments, often targeting specific diseases or patient groups.
